EduTech: Interlinked Platform for National Education Data
This major project involved designing and developing an integrated web platform aimed at synchronizing student data across School, Higher, and Technical Education verticals in India. The core motivation was to overcome the lack of a centralized student database needed for effective educational policy framing and intervention.
The project successfully demonstrates expertise in data integration, Python back-end development (Flask), and the capacity to build systems with significant social and governmental policy implications, resulting in three peer-reviewed publications.
The Policy & Data Problem
-
Gap in Master Database
Framing targeted education policies is difficult due to the absence of a master database tracking students across various academic levels (school to technical).
-
Objective: Dropout and Grey Area Identification
The platform's key objective was to enable the identification of dropout percentages (State/District-wise) and grey areas requiring specific resource allocation, providing real-time data for policy makers.
Technical Architecture
- Python (Flask) - Back-end application logic
- HTML/CSS/JavaScript - Front-End interface
- MS Access / pyodbc - Database integration method
- Matplotlib & Pandas - Data visualization and analysis tools
- Database Schema Design - Planning the interlinked data model
- NetApp/Cloud - Consideration for deployment and storage solutions
